UNCOMMON — Definition of UNCOMMON

8 letters
/ʌnˈkɒmən/
adjective
1
Rare; not readily found; unusual.
Bald eagles are an uncommon sighting in this state
2
Remarkable; exceptional.
The diamond was of uncommon size
Synonyms
adverb
1
Exceedingly, exceptionally.
